Инженерия запросов
Как составлять эффективные промпты
Основы составления запросов
Умение правильно составлять запросы (промпты) к ИИ — ключевой навык для эффективной работы с платформой.
Промпт — это ваш запрос к искусственному интеллекту. От качества и точности запроса напрямую зависит результат, который вы получите.
- Конкретность — описывайте желаемый результат максимально точно
- Полнота — указывайте все важные детали и контекст
- Структурированность — выделяйте ключевые моменты, используйте списки
- Ясность — избегайте двусмысленных формулировок
Сравнение запросов:
❌ Неэффективно: “Сделай сайт.”
✅ Эффективно: “Создай лендинг для кофейни с разделами: меню, локации, контакты и форма бронирования столика.”
❌ Неэффективно: “Это не работает, почини!”
✅ Эффективно: “На странице контактов не отправляется форма обратной связи. Проверь код отправки формы.”
Контекст
Объясните, что вы хотите создать и для какой цели.
Я хочу создать сайт для своей фотостудии, чтобы привлекать новых клиентов.
Конкретные требования
Перечислите необходимые функции и элементы.
Сайт должен включать: галерею работ, информацию об услугах с ценами, контактную форму и возможность записи на фотосессию.
Стилистические предпочтения
Опишите, как должен выглядеть результат.
Стиль минималистичный, с черно-белой цветовой схемой и акцентами бирюзового цвета.
Ограничения
Укажите, что следует учесть или избежать.
Сайт должен хорошо работать на мобильных устройствах. Не нужны анимации, чтобы фотографии загружались быстрее.
Использование примеров
Приведите примеры желаемого результата для большей ясности.
Мне нужен сайт в стиле минимализм, как современные лендинги для IT-продуктов, с преобладанием белого цвета и синими акцентами.
Поэтапный подход
Разбивайте сложные задачи на последовательные шаги.
Сначала создай главную страницу. После утверждения дизайна перейдем к странице каталога.
Обратная связь
Оценивайте полученные результаты и корректируйте запросы.
В целом нравится, но увеличь размер шрифта заголовков и добавь больше пространства между секциями.
Начинайте с общего плана
Сначала определите основную структуру и функциональность.
Давай спланируем структуру сервиса аренды недвижимости. Какие основные разделы и функции должны быть на сайте?
Переходите к деталям
После определения общей структуры, прорабатывайте ключевые компоненты.
Теперь детально проработаем страницу объявления. Она должна включать:
- Фотогалерею
- Характеристики объекта
- Карту с расположением
- Информацию о владельце
- Возможность бронирования
Уточняйте конкретные элементы
Детализируйте отдельные элементы интерфейса и функционала.
Доработай форму бронирования. Добавь выбор даты заезда/выезда, количество гостей и поле для сообщения владельцу.
Улучшение проекта
Техники эффективной отладки
Уточняйте проблему
Точно опишите, что именно не работает и в каком контексте.
На странице контактов не работает отправка формы. Проверь, правильно ли настроен обработчик события отправки.
Спрашивайте о решениях
Ищите альтернативные подходы к реализации функционала.
Какие есть альтернативные способы реализации слайдера изображений без использования тяжелых библиотек?
Используйте пошаговый подход
Разбивайте сложные проблемы на простые шаги.
Давай решать эту проблему постепенно:
- Сначала проверим правильность HTML-структуры
- Затем проверим стили CSS
- И наконец посмотрим JavaScript-функционал
Совет: После исправления ошибки попросите ИИ объяснить, что было не так, чтобы в будущем вы могли избежать подобных проблем.
Шаблоны запросов для оптимизации
-
Улучшение производительности
Проанализируй код на наличие проблем с производительностью. Обрати внимание на:
- Неоптимальные запросы к данным
- Избыточные перерисовки компонентов
- Тяжелые ресурсы (изображения, скрипты)
-
Улучшение пользовательского опыта
Оцени пользовательский интерфейс с точки зрения удобства использования. Предложи улучшения для:
- Навигации по сайту
- Форм ввода данных
- Мобильной версии
-
Улучшение кода
Выполни рефакторинг этого компонента для улучшения читаемости и поддерживаемости. Соблюдай принципы чистого кода и следуй современным стандартам.
Если вы не получаете желаемый результат, попробуйте следующие стратегии:
Уточните запрос
Добавьте больше деталей и контекста, используйте более конкретные формулировки.
Вместо “Сделай красивый сайт” используйте “Создай одностраничный сайт для кофейни с разделами меню, о нас и контакты, в теплых коричневых тонах”.
Дробите сложные запросы
Разбейте сложный запрос на несколько простых шагов.
Давай создадим сайт по частям. Сначала спроектируем главную страницу, затем добавим функционал каталога товаров, и в конце настроим корзину и оформление заказа.
Используйте визуальные примеры
Прикрепите изображения для наглядного пояснения ваших идей.
Я прикрепляю фотографию интерьера, который мне нравится. Используй похожий стиль для дизайна веб-страницы.
Помните: Искусственный интеллект — это инструмент, который учится понимать вас лучше с каждым взаимодействием. Чем больше вы с ним работаете, тем лучше он адаптируется к вашему стилю и требованиям.
Примеры хороших запросов
Создай одностраничный сайт для кофейни "Утренний Аромат" со следующими разделами:
1. Главный экран с приветствием и фотографией интерьера
2. О нас - краткая история кофейни (основана в 2018 году, специализируется на спешиалти кофе)
3. Меню - разделы: кофе, чай, десерты, завтраки
4. Контакты и карта расположения (адрес: ул. Пушкина, 15)
Стиль: уютный, теплые коричневые и кремовые тона, шрифты без засечек.
Важно: сайт должен быть адаптивным для мобильных устройств.
Советы
-
Будьте точными — чем точнее запрос, тем точнее результат
-
Используйте списки — это помогает ИИ лучше организовать ответ
-
Давайте обратную связь — оценивайте результаты и уточняйте детали
-
Пробуйте разные подходы — экспериментируйте с формулировками запросов